Lucknow: The Uttar Pradesh government carried out a fresh round of administrative transfers late Thursday night, transferring five IAS officers and six PCS officers to new assignments across district administration, urban local bodies and the state government.
The transfer orders, issued at around 10:30 p.m., include changes in the postings of the District Magistrates of Jalaun and Bahraich, along with several other administrative shifts.
Rajesh Kumar Pandey Appointed Bahraich DM
Rajesh Kumar Pandey, a 2012-batch promoted IAS officer who was serving as District Magistrate of Jalaun, has been transferred and appointed the new District Magistrate of Bahraich.
His transfer is part of the latest round of field-level administrative changes undertaken by the state government.
Sameer Appointed Jalaun District Magistrate
Sameer, a 2015-batch IAS officer, has been moved from the state government to a field posting.
He was serving as Special Secretary in the IT and Electronics Department and Managing Director of UPDESCO. He has now been appointed District Magistrate of Jalaun, replacing Rajesh Kumar Pandey.
The move brings a new administrative head to Jalaun while also creating vacancies in the IT and Electronics Department and at UPDESCO, which have been addressed through the reshuffle.
Akanksha Rana Moved to IT and Electronics Department
Akanksha Rana, a 2017-batch IAS officer, has been transferred from her post as Municipal Commissioner of Jhansi Municipal Corporation to the state government.
She has been appointed Special Secretary in the IT and Electronics Department and Managing Director of UPDESCO.
Her transfer marks a move from urban local-body administration to a key state-level assignment involving the government’s IT and technology-related initiatives.
B. Suthan Appointed Jhansi Municipal Commissioner
- Suthan, a 2020-batch IAS officer who was serving as Chief Development Officer (CDO) of Barabanki, has been appointed Municipal Commissioner of Jhansi Municipal Corporation.
He will take charge of the city’s municipal administration following Akanksha Rana’s transfer to the state government.
Pankaj Verma Gets Barabanki CDO Charge
Pankaj Verma, a 2022-batch promoted IAS officer serving as Secretary of the Moradabad Development Authority, has been appointed Chief Development Officer of Barabanki.

Six PCS Officers Also Transferred
Along with the five IAS officers, the Uttar Pradesh government has also changed the postings of six Provincial Civil Service (PCS) officers.
The changes include:
- Rajesh Kumar Singh: SDM, Badaun → Additional District Magistrate (Civil Supplies), Kanpur Nagar.
- Sanjay Kumar Singh: ADM, Gonda → Deputy Director (Administration), Youth Welfare and Prantiya Rakshak Dal.
- Pramod Jha: City Magistrate, Jhansi → ADM, Gonda.
- Yogeshwar Singh: SDM, Kushinagar → City Magistrate, Jhansi.
The latest orders have altered the responsibilities of a total of 11 IAS and PCS officers.
Fresh Transfers Follow Wednesday’s Postings
The latest reshuffle comes a day after another round of administrative changes in Uttar Pradesh.
On Wednesday night, IAS officer Aparajita Arya was appointed Sub-Divisional Magistrate (SDM) of Malihabad, while Manoj Singh was moved from the SDM post to the position of ACS-5.
With another five IAS officers being transferred on Thursday night, the Yogi Adityanath government has continued its ongoing review of administrative assignments.

Five IAS Officers Transferred: At a Glance
- Rajesh Kumar Pandey: District Magistrate, Jalaun → District Magistrate, Bahraich.
- Sameer: Special Secretary, IT and Electronics Department & MD, UPDESCO → District Magistrate, Jalaun.
- Akanksha Rana: Municipal Commissioner, Jhansi → Special Secretary, IT and Electronics Department & MD, UPDESCO.
- B. Suthan: CDO, Barabanki → Municipal Commissioner, Jhansi.
- Pankaj Verma: Secretary, Moradabad Development Authority → CDO, Barabanki.
